Taxes for Free · Pay.Fortunately, the IRS offers a "safe harbor" from underpayment penalties for individuals who pay their quarterly estimated taxes in one of the following ways. You can pay 100% of your tax liability amount from the prior year, divided into four equal payments. For example, if you owed $5,000 for 2021, you'd spend $1,250 each quarter in 2022.The CARES Act expanded unemployment benefits to self-employed people, and you might also qualify for a PPP or other SBA loan. The most expensive tax-filing tier -- Self-Employed -- costs $90 for federal and state returns, and it comes with email support, live chat and help from a self-employment tax professional.We began our analysis by looking at nine popular online tax software providers: Cash App ...SE tax is a Social Security and Medicare tax primarily for individuals who work for themselves. It is similar to the Social Security and Medicare taxes withheld from the pay of most wage earners. In general, the wording "self-employment tax" only refers to Social Security and Medicare taxes and not any other tax (like income tax). Best for Live Tax Advice: TurboTax Premier. The self-employment tax rate for 2023 is 15.3 percent, which encompasses the 12.4 percent Social Security tax and the 2.9 percent Medicare tax. Self-employment tax applies to your net earnings ...
